My treatment methods

Cognitive Behavioral (CBT)

I’ve been using CBT in my practice for the past five years. It’s helped dozens of clients challenge reoccurring thoughts and manage their anxiety and symptoms. We’ll use CBT to recognize how your thoughts, feelings, and behaviors influence each other. We’ll then use that knowledge to change your thinking patterns, which will help you lead a less anxious and stressed life.

Dialectical Behavior (DBT)

I’ve been using DBT in my practice as a DBT certified therapist. DBT allows clients to develop tools to develop a balanced and non-reactive relationship with their thoughts and emotions. utilizing DBT I assist clients with developing the tools to engage in mindfulness exercises, practice emotional regulation, acceptance and change.

Solution Focused Brief Treatment

Utilizing a Solution Focused Approach in my practice allows clients to develop the tools to focus on solutions rather than fixating on the problem. A Solution-Focused approach, is an evidence-based approach that focuses on what clients want to achieve through therapy rather than analyzing the problems that brought them into treatment

Trauma-Focused CBT

I’ve been using TF-CBT in my practice for the past five years. It’s helped dozens of clients and parents recognize and respond appropriately to traumatic experiences and responses. TF-CBT focuses on addressing the mental health needs of individuals who have experienced traumatic events. I support families and clients with the developing the tools to process their trauma.
